Explore collaborative solutions for distributed C++ development teams in this ACCU Conference talk. Delve into common challenges faced by remote developers and discover practical tools to enhance teamwork. Learn about Live Share for real-time code sharing, CMake Presets for cross-IDE compatibility, and cloud-based IDE instances for seamless collaboration. Gain insights from Microsoft product managers Sinem Akinci and Alexandra Kemper on optimizing workflows, overcoming communication barriers, and fostering productive partnerships in modern C++ development environments.
